I solved it. It was actually very obvious, I just had to manually install the missing package,
i.e. npm install to-style

However, to-style was supposed to be installed automatically after cloning the repo and executing npm install, which didn't happen, probably because it wasn't listed in packages.json, so that's something that needs to be looked into.
